Embracing bold colors


One of the standout trends in kitchen design for 2024 is the use of bold colors. Gone are the days when kitchens were dominated by neutral tones. Today, vibrant hues are making a strong statement.


Statement cabinetry


Cabinetry is no longer just about storage; it’s a canvas for color expression. Deep blues, forest greens, and rich burgundies are replacing traditional whites and grays. These colors add depth and personality to the kitchen, making it a more inviting space.


Colorful backsplashes


Backsplashes are another area where color is being embraced. Instead of the usual white subway tiles, homeowners are opting for patterned tiles in bold colors. These eye-catching designs serve as focal points and add a touch of artistry to the kitchen.


Sustainable materials


Sustainability continues to be a significant influence in kitchen design. Homeowners are increasingly choosing eco-friendly materials that are both beautiful and sustainable.


Reclaimed wood


Reclaimed wood is becoming a popular choice for kitchen cabinetry and flooring. This material not only adds a rustic charm but also promotes recycling and reduces the demand for new timber.


Bamboo and cork


Bamboo and cork are also gaining popularity as sustainable flooring options. Both materials are renewable, durable, and add a unique texture to the kitchen space.


Smart kitchens


The integration of technology in kitchen design has revolutionized how we cook and interact with our kitchens. Smart kitchens are equipped with advanced gadgets and appliances that make cooking more convenient and enjoyable.


Smart appliances


From refrigerators that can create shopping lists to ovens that can be controlled via smartphone, smart appliances are making kitchens more efficient. These appliances often come with energy-saving features, making them environmentally friendly as well.


Voice-activated assistants


Voice-activated assistants like Amazon Alexa and Google Home are becoming common in modern kitchens. They can help with tasks such as setting timers, finding recipes, and even controlling other smart appliances.


Multi-functional islands


Kitchen islands have always been a popular feature, but their functionality is expanding. In 2024, kitchen islands are designed to serve multiple purposes, making them a versatile addition to any kitchen.


Cooking and prep stations


Islands are being equipped with built-in cooktops, sinks, and prep areas. This setup allows for more efficient cooking and better use of space, especially in smaller kitchens.


Dining and socializing


In addition to being a prep area, islands are also becoming central social hubs. With added seating, they can function as informal dining areas or spaces for entertaining guests while
cooking.


Minimalist designs


While bold colors and multi-functional islands are trending, there is also a movement towards minimalist kitchen designs. These designs focus on simplicity, clean lines, and clutter-free spaces.


Streamlined cabinetry


Handleless cabinets and drawers are a hallmark of minimalist kitchen design. These features create a sleek and seamless look, contributing to a more organized and spacious feel.


Open shelving


Open shelving is replacing upper cabinets in many modern kitchens. This design choice not only adds a minimalist aesthetic but also makes it easier to access and display kitchen essentials.


Natural elements


Incorporating natural elements into kitchen design is another trend gaining momentum. This approach brings a touch of nature indoors and creates a calming and welcoming environment.


Stone countertops


Natural stone countertops, such as granite, marble, and quartz, are highly sought after. These materials offer durability and a timeless elegance that enhances the overall look of the kitchen.


Indoor plants


Adding indoor plants to the kitchen is a simple yet effective way to incorporate natural elements. Plants can purify the air, add a splash of color, and create a more vibrant and healthy kitchen space.
